(1) Financial institutions may offer debt cancellation products, and charge fees for such products, in connection with the loans, leases, and similar extensions of credit made by the financial institutions, pursuant to sections 655.947 and 655.954, F.S., and the rules and orders of the Commission and the Office.
    (2) Rules 69U-100.100 through 69U-100.106, F.A.C., set forth the standards that apply to debt cancellation products offered by financial institutions. The purpose of these standards is to ensure that financial institutions offer debt cancellation products consistent with safe and sound financial institution practices, and subject to appropriate consumer protection.
    (3) Rules 69U-100.100 through 69U-100.106, F.A.C., apply to all contracts and agreements for debt cancellation products entered into by financial institutions in connection with extensions of credit they make, purchase, or assume.
